WordPress Core "wp2shell" RCE flaws get public exploits, patch now

Public exploits have been released for critical remote code execution vulnerabilities in WordPress Core, tracked as "wp2shell." These flaws allow attackers to execute arbitrary code on vulnerable servers, potentially leading to full site compromise. The vulnerabilities affect all versions of WordPress prior to the latest security patch. WordPress developers have released a patch, and administrators are urged to update immediately. The exploits were published on security research platforms, increasing the risk of widespread attacks. This is a high-severity issue for the millions of websites running WordPress.
